// Code generated by software.amazon.smithy.rust.codegen.smithy-rs. DO NOT EDIT.

/// <p></p>
#[non_exhaustive]
#[derive(::std::clone::Clone, ::std::cmp::PartialEq, ::std::fmt::Debug)]
pub struct ModifyEventSubscriptionInput {
    /// <p>The name of the RDS event notification subscription.</p>
    pub subscription_name: ::std::option::Option<::std::string::String>,
    /// <p>The Amazon Resource Name (ARN) of the SNS topic created for event notification. The ARN is created by Amazon SNS when you create a topic and subscribe to it.</p>
    pub sns_topic_arn: ::std::option::Option<::std::string::String>,
    /// <p>The type of source that is generating the events. For example, if you want to be notified of events generated by a DB instance, you would set this parameter to db-instance. For RDS Proxy events, specify <code>db-proxy</code>. If this value isn't specified, all events are returned.</p>
    /// <p>Valid Values:<code> db-instance | db-cluster | db-parameter-group | db-security-group | db-snapshot | db-cluster-snapshot | db-proxy | zero-etl | custom-engine-version | blue-green-deployment </code></p>
    pub source_type: ::std::option::Option<::std::string::String>,
    /// <p>A list of event categories for a source type (<code>SourceType</code>) that you want to subscribe to. You can see a list of the categories for a given source type in <a href="https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/USER_Events.html">Events</a> in the <i>Amazon RDS User Guide</i> or by using the <code>DescribeEventCategories</code> operation.</p>
    pub event_categories: ::std::option::Option<::std::vec::Vec<::std::string::String>>,
    /// <p>Specifies whether to activate the subscription.</p>
    pub enabled: ::std::option::Option<bool>,
}
